Evaluating options requires a balanced approach that considers both financial outcomes and ethical implications. The following key aspects are crucial in this evaluation:

Consideration of Stakeholders

When making decisions in financial contexts, it’s imperative to consider the impacts on all involved stakeholders, which include clients, colleagues, and the firm itself. A failure to adequately consider stakeholder needs can lead to adverse consequences both legally and reputationally.

Regulatory Compliance

Ensuring decisions align with laws, regulations, and industry standards is non-negotiable. Compliance not only shields you and your firm from legal repercussions but also reinforces ethical standards and trust with clients.
